Document management specialist M-Files has announced a series of new integrations with Microsoft 365 Copilot and Microsoft 365 Copilot Agent Builder, building on its existing strategic partnership with the tech giant.
The new experiences are designed to help organisations extract greater value from their AI investments by grounding outputs in trusted, context-enriched content stored natively within Microsoft 365.
The company, which positions itself as a context-first document management system, says the latest developments go well beyond a standard integration. Employees can now access M-Files content through Microsoft 365 in the same way they would interact with SharePoint or OneDrive, while simultaneously benefiting from M-Files’ metadata-driven, context-aware approach to information management.
Three core advantages underpin the new offering. First, Microsoft 365 Copilot outputs are anchored in M-Files’ permission-aware architecture, meaning all surfaced content respects individual user access rights and aligns with organisational policies.
Second, M-Files provides context-rich information that helps Copilot and Copilot Agent Builder understand how key business concepts — such as customers, contracts, processes, and components — are interrelated, enabling more sophisticated reasoning and AI-driven automation.
Third, by allowing staff to find and utilise trusted knowledge directly inside Microsoft 365, the integration reduces context-switching and time lost navigating disparate systems, with the aim of delivering a stronger return on existing Microsoft investments.

The announcement comes as M-Files continues to strengthen its standing within the Microsoft ecosystem. The company was recently recognised by Microsoft as the winner of the 2025 Marketplace Solution Partner of the Year in Finland, and holds the distinction of being the first document management system to leverage SharePoint Embedded — a move the company says helps organisations maximise their Microsoft investment and reduce operational friction.
